Transaction d903a63e66f58930161161572dabebdf6c7c16c39bd495ee8ca4155087f8fb8a
1 Input
1 Output
-
d903a63e66f58930161161572dabebdf6c7c16c39bd495ee8ca4155087f8fb8a:0
- value
- 500090
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8635bfdd1ff4c2e5dac7a25ec288e2d2f67c196
- address
- bc1qap34hlw3laxzuhdv0gj7c2yw95hk0svk402pnp